2 Ohio State at 13 Penn State 12:00 FOX OSU -15.5
Penn State's offense looked good vs Minnesota. Their OC actually adjusted his gameplan to use TEs and attack the middle. Imagine that, adjusting a gameplan to attack a team's weakness. What a concept.
Penn State's OL seemed improved but now they have some injuries so the OL is back to Iffy. Clifford had a great game vs Minnesota and the WRs stepped up with some big plays. PSU had been really trying to develop their run game most of the year but vs Minnesota they got more aggressive passing. They'll have to score a bunch of points to keep up with OSU
Ohio State's offense is great, so many weapons. Penn State's defense matches up much better vs OSU than Michigan. That's why PSU almost always plays close with OSU.
Key matchup could be CB Joey Porter Jr vs WR Marvin Harrison Jr.
The big question is Ohio State's defense. They have not played a single offense that's even halfway decent. Penn State's offense isn't great but they are far better than any OSU has faced and are the first team that has some actual athletes that can make plays.
For Ohio State, this is likely their last hurdle before the matchup with Michigan.
For Penn State to have a shot, they need to force some turnovers and they have to make some chunk plays vs an OSU defense that hsn't really been tested yet. I'm just hoping they can play a close game then finsih the rest of the season strong.
